Concept Note on COVID-19 Response in Kirtipur, Nepal
"As the global pandemic, COVID-19 spreads at a rapid rate and positive cases are seen in Nepal, it’s an urgency to organize and save our community before it spreads at community level.
As Nepal steps ahead to fight with COVID19, all three governments systems plan and prepare to regulate the unavoidable risk of the disease. As funds are lacking, the government appeals every citizen and organization to join the fight against the virus. Every local level administration has to plan and prepare for the prevention, treatment and care.
In response to the present situation, Rarahil Foundation, a community based organisation, has proposed to support Kirtipur Municipality to effectively run a quarantine and isolation ward in community.
For the support of the government, and our beneficiaries community, Kirtipur Municipality in coordination with different stakeholders aims to support the healthcare system of the working area with the PPE and medical supplies. The proposed project is envisaged to achive the following objectives.
Objective
- To provide preliminary treatment facilities to local healthcare system in coordination with local government in order to prevent COVID-19 transmission at community level
- To provide personal protective equipment for the individuals who will be handling the cases in frontline
Beneficiaries
20,000 people in Kirtipur ( Indirectly 50,000 people)
Rationale of the Project
Due to global pandemic and resource constraint, there is lack of Personal Protection Equipments (PPE) and medical supplies for medical professions. The proposed project will contribute to purchase PPE and medical supplies in order to effectively contribute for prevention of COVID-19 in community.
Implementation of the Project
The proposed project will be implemented by Kirtipur Rural Municipality, Kirtipur in coordination with with Rarahil Foundation. Fund will be deposited in Emergency fund of Kirtipur Municipality and follow up of the project will be carried out by Rarahill Foundation, Kirtipur"
In Kirtipur, also 500 students from Tribhuvan University are
stranded due to the lockdown. The Municipality provides them with food
packages in order to survive those challenging times far away from their
families living in rural areas of Nepal.
